Thus apparently a normal memory alloc, but what about that number?
Oct 23 16:41:01 HOSTNAME radosgw[1616]: tcmalloc: large alloc
94195528343552 bytes == (nil) @
94195528343552 = 0x55AB9B01A000
not an overflow/negative, but pointer in the range of data pointers
seen in the stack.
apparently similar to what is seen in other case of corruption / next
coredump.
req=0x55ab9b020930
client_io=client_io@entry=0x55ab9b0209c0
this=0x55ab9b021f60
(gdb) | info files | grep 55ab9b // 0x55AB9B0_1, 0x55ab9b0_2
0x000055ab98fe4000 - 0x000055ab9b1a2000 is load5
in stack, between frames 0-4.
(gdb) frame 4
(gdb) info reg $rsp
rsp 0x55ab9b01ecc0 0x55ab9b01ecc0
(gdb) frame 0
(gdb) info reg $rsp
rsp 0x55ab9b017cb0 0x55ab9b017cb0
